I would not recommend this printer. You have to install the print heads. It at times makes a high pitch penetrating noises. I’m constantly getting error messages. Printing double sided pages one must run the paper through twice. It prints all odd pages then you have to reinsert paper for the second side. For the price of this printer I’m very disappointed and wish I could return and get a different one.
